The Bandits were scheduled to fish Indian Creek Dam last weekend but due to possible heavy rains they decided to head to Lake Tschida to avoid getting stuck on gravel roads. It was tough making that choice because there were a lot of anglers looking forward to returning to Indian Creek. The Bandits made their appearance for the first time back in 2009. That day the lake didn’t fish up to its potential but perhaps we will try to go there again another year.

Regardless of where the Bandits fish it will always be a good time and Lake Tschida provided the club with great fishing had by all. For the second time in a row records were broken. The previous tournament lake record for Lake Tschida was 7.62 lbs that was held by Jeanette Reinbold set back in 2013 but Chase Fernandez had the lucky had today. Chase took home the first place prize and a 100 points towards the Angler of the Year standings by weighing in 8.47. Not only did this bring him first place but it’s a new tournament record for Lake Tschida. Good job Chase! Another club member who had a great day was Steve Basinger who weighed in 8.43 which also broke the old record. Steve took home a 2nd place finish but he also took home a nice paycheck thanks to weighing in the biggest bass of the tournament a 3.44 lber! Nice work Steve! Also breaking the old club record was Shawn Keena who boated 3 nice keeper smallmouth that allowed him to take home a 3rd place finish by weighing in 7.94 lbs. Honorable mentions of the tournament go out to our last two anglers who rounded out the top 5 which were Bob Reinbold with 7.86 and Tony Reinbold 7.47 lbs. Congratulations to all of our anglers.

As mentioned above Lake Tschida provided ample fishing for our club members because the average weight per fish was 2.53 lbs! This average bested the old lake record set way back in 2007 which was 2.17 lbs! So once again the Bandits were blessed with another great tournament twice in a row. It is shaping up to be a great year. Speaking of shaping up the Angler of the Year award has shifted and Chase Fernandez is your current points leader. The current club member that is leading the Rookie of the year standings is Hunter Wood with 188 points and in second place is Allison Gaw with 138 points.
